Safety Tips and Prevention Strategies

Given the constant stream of accident news today, it's essential for all of us, guys, to focus on prevention. Being aware of potential hazards is the first step, but actively implementing safety strategies is where we truly make a difference. Let's start with road safety, as it's often the most prominent category in accident reports. The golden rules remain constant: avoid distractions like your phone, never drive under the influence of alcohol or drugs, and always maintain a safe following distance. Speed kills, so adhering to posted limits and adjusting your speed based on conditions – rain, fog, snow, or even heavy traffic – is non-negotiable. Defensive driving isn't just a buzzword; it's a mindset. Anticipate the actions of others, check your mirrors frequently, and signal your intentions clearly and well in advance. Remember to ensure your vehicle is well-maintained, with good tires, brakes, and lights. A quick pre-trip check can prevent a world of trouble.

Beyond driving, let's consider workplace safety. Many accidents happen on the job, and companies have a responsibility to provide a safe environment, but employees also play a critical role. Follow all safety protocols and training diligently. Use personal protective equipment (PPE) when required, report any unsafe conditions immediately, and take breaks to avoid fatigue, which is a major contributor to accidents. If you're in a role that involves physical labor or operating machinery, never become complacent. Constant vigilance and adherence to procedure are paramount. We’ve all heard stories of accidents happening because someone thought they knew better or decided to cut a corner. It’s rarely worth the risk, guys. Your health and well-being are far more valuable than saving a few minutes or skipping a step.

And what about home safety? Accidental injuries can happen right under our own roofs. Think about preventing falls by keeping walkways clear of clutter, ensuring adequate lighting, and using non-slip mats in bathrooms and kitchens. Secure electrical cords to avoid tripping hazards, and store cleaning supplies and medications safely out of reach of children. For those with pools, safety fences and constant supervision are a must. Even simple things like properly using ladders or handling tools safely can prevent serious injury.
